Chrome崩溃可按六步排查:一禁用扩展;二关闭硬件加速;三禁用RendererCodeIntegrity校验;四重置用户配置文件;五禁用沙盒(高风险);六运行SFC和DISM修复系统文件。

一、禁用所有浏览器扩展插件
第三方扩展插件可能与 Chrome 渲染器或内存管理机制发生冲突,导致非法内存访问行为。禁用全部扩展可快速验证是否由某款插件引发崩溃。
1、在 Chrome 地址栏输入 chrome://extensions/ 并回车。
2、将页面顶部的“开发者模式”开关打开(如未开启)。
3、逐个关闭所有已启用的扩展,或直接点击右上角“全部停用”按钮。
4、关闭当前窗口,重新启动 Chrome 浏览器并访问原崩溃网页测试。
二、关闭硬件加速功能
硬件加速依赖显卡驱动协同渲染,当驱动异常或 GPU 内存映射出错时,极易触发 STATUS_ACCESS_VIOLATION。关闭该选项可强制使用 CPU 渲染,规避 GPU 相关内存违规。
1、在 Chrome 地址栏输入 chrome://settings/ 并回车。
2、滚动至页面最底部,点击“高级”展开更多设置项。
3、在“系统”区域中,取消勾选 “使用硬件加速模式(如果可用)”。
4、点击右下角“重启”按钮使设置生效。
三、禁用渲染器代码完整性校验
Chrome 自 2022 年起默认启用 RendererCodeIntegrity 功能,用于验证网页脚本签名。但在部分系统环境或安全软件干预下,该机制可能误判合法代码为恶意,强行中断内存读写流程,从而抛出 STATUS_ACCESS_VIOLATION。
1、右键桌面或开始菜单中的 Chrome 快捷方式,选择“属性”。
2、切换到“快捷方式”选项卡,在“目标”文本框末尾添加一个英文空格,然后追加:--disable-features=RendererCodeIntegrity。
3、点击“确定”保存修改。
4、若浏览器固定在任务栏,需先取消固定,再用新修改的快捷方式重新固定。
四、重置 Chrome 用户配置文件
用户配置文件中存储的偏好设置、同步数据及本地缓存可能已损坏,尤其当崩溃集中发生在登录态或特定网站时,新建干净配置文件可隔离问题根源。
1、在 Chrome 地址栏输入 chrome://settings/manageProfile 并回车。
2、点击“添加”按钮,创建一个新用户(无需登录 Google 账户)。
3、在新用户头像下点击“打开”,启动独立配置文件的 Chrome 实例。
4、尝试访问此前崩溃的网页,观察是否仍出现 STATUS_ACCESS_VIOLATION。
五、禁用沙盒机制(高风险操作)
Chrome 沙盒通过限制渲染进程权限来防止恶意代码访问系统资源,但某些企业策略、深度安全软件或兼容性补丁会干扰沙盒初始化过程,造成内存访问权限异常。禁用沙盒虽能绕过崩溃,但会显著降低浏览器安全性。
1、右键 Chrome 快捷方式,选择“属性”。
2、在“快捷方式”选项卡的“目标”末尾添加空格后追加:--test-type --no-sandbox。
3、点击“确定”保存。
4、仅通过此快捷方式启动浏览器,切勿通过任务栏、开始菜单或其他入口运行。
六、执行系统文件完整性修复
Windows 系统核心文件(如 ntdll.dll、kernel32.dll)若被篡改或损坏,可能导致所有调用 Windows API 的程序(含 Chrome)在内存分配或释放阶段触发 STATUS_ACCESS_VIOLATION。SFC 和 DISM 工具可自动定位并替换受损文件。
1、同时按下 Win + R 键,输入 cmd,再按 Ctrl + Shift + Enter 以管理员身份运行命令提示符。
2、输入命令:sfc /scannow 并回车,等待扫描完成。
3、扫描结束后,输入命令:DISM /Online /Cleanup-Image /RestoreHealth 并回车,等待执行完毕。
4、重启计算机后再次测试 Chrome 是否仍崩溃。











